An Elmwood Trail is a life-or-death mystery that kept me invested

Is there anything better than a good mystery? Solving clues, questioning suspects, and getting down to the nitty-gritty of some shading doings? An Elmwood Trail is an episodic interactive mystery where my goal was to solve the case of a missing girl named Zoey. It was incredibly satisfying to immerse myself in the story. The puzzles are complex without being impossible to beat. The music added an eerie tone and made it feel something was "off" during my playthrough. Not to mention that the cool UI made it seem I was really scrolling through Zoey's lost phone. If you're looking for a game that'll put your skills to the test, An Elmwood Trail is definitely for you.

DYSMANTLE - A LESS HARDCORE Zombie Apocalypse SURVIVAL GAME!

I recently had the pleasure of playing the Zombie Survival game 'Dysmantle' and I was super happy with how the game played. In Dysmantle you start off as a lone survivor who has run out of food after the zombie apocalypse, and you must come up from your shelter to see what you can find. You're first tasked with finding materials to upgrade your crowbar with after finding an abandoned camp. You have to destroy the wooden chairs and barbecue stands to get the scrap wood and metal needed to upgrade. Once you have the items you go back to your camp to upgrade the crowbar. Now with your upgraded crowbar, you can break through larger obstacles. The game does have quests for you to complete in order to get your story going.

Bramble: The Mountain King is a gorgeous game that introduced me to the dark world of Nordic fables

PLAY IT OR SKIP IT? Play it! Bramble: The Mountain King is by far one of the best titles I’ve played this year. It uses beautiful visuals to bring Nordic folklore’s magical and sinister elements to life. Admittedly, I don’t know much about Nordic fables, but hopping into Bramble felt like jumping into a very dark story written by the Brothers Grimm. Whether I was befriending gnomes, dodging zombies, or chasing a child-murdering witch, the narrative made me feel like a child being read to and constantly wondering at what might happen next.

A portable citybuilder that will keep you busy for hours

Pocket City 2 is a solid citybuilder packed with interesting features. The basic gameplay loop is pretty standard—place roads, construct buildings, earn money for more buildings—but there are unique mechanics that take things in an exciting new direction. Whenever I needed a break from building, I could jump into my city, walk around, and explore. Not only was this a great way to see my city up close, but I actually made some pretty cool discoveries, like a hammer I could use to repair roads for free. There's even a photo mode, so I could snap pictures of all my favorite spots.

All done with Super Mario RPG? Here's the colorful action-RPG you'll want to play next

Very few RPGs manage to capture the sense of whimsy and adventure of Super Mario RPG, so when one comes along, we take notice. That's why we couldn't look away when we saw the absolutely adorable and fun-looking Born of Bread. This RPG puts players into the shoes of Loaf, a "flour golem" who must journey the world and make new friends while solving a perplexing mystery. Like Super Mario RPG, Born of Bread's combat system is technically turn-based, but different moves allow players to do extra damage by completing timing-based challenges. So it requires a little more attention than the average turn-based RPG, where you might just tap "attack" over and over.

The Storyline Keeps You Guessing in Delivery From The Pain...

Delivery From The Pain has to be one of the best indie games I have ever played. The initial cost is around $4 USD (currently on sale) available on google play or IOS store. The gameplay consists of you exploring areas in this post apocalyptic world filled with zombies. The game gives you a top-down view of the environment with tons of tiny details. The game also focuses on the stealth aspect causing you to sneak around the environments and attack zombies only at the most opportune times. The game was developed by just 7 people which took them 2 years to make. The beginning has you choose 1 of 2 starting characters. 1 is a male and the other a female both with different stats in skills.

A Captivating and Twisted Journey into Darkness - Fran Bow

In the dark and eerie world of Fran Bow, you'll embark on a twisted adventure through the mind of a young girl named Fran. With a captivating art style and a well-crafted story, this indie point-and-click adventure is a must-play for fans of psychological horror. Let's begin with the game's visuals. Fran Bow boasts a uniquely hand-drawn art style that is both beautiful and macabre.
